New modular multiplication and division algorithms based on continued fraction expansion
Mourad Gouicem

TL;DR
This paper introduces new algorithms for modular multiplication and division utilizing continued fraction expansions, based on the Euclidean algorithm, offering quadratic complexity solutions for modular arithmetic operations.
Contribution
The paper presents novel algorithms for modular multiplication and division that leverage continued fraction expansions, enhancing computational methods in modular arithmetic.
Findings
Algorithms are based on the Euclidean algorithm.
Both algorithms have quadratic complexity.
They improve computational efficiency in modular arithmetic.
Abstract
In this paper, we apply results on number systems based on continued fraction expansions to modular arithmetic. We provide two new algorithms in order to compute modular multiplication and modular division. The presented algorithms are based on the Euclidean algorithm and are of quadratic complexity.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sNumerical Methods and Algorithms · Cryptography and Residue Arithmetic · Coding theory and cryptography
